Many businesses in Qatar decide to implement ERP systems to improve efficiency, but a large number of ERP projects fail because of poor planning and incorrect implementation. Choosing the right system is only the first step. The real success comes from how the system is implemented and configured for your business.
At Top Cliff Consultancy, we work with companies across Qatar that want to implement Odoo ERP correctly from the beginning. Through our experience, we have seen that businesses often struggle with unclear implementation strategies, data migration challenges, and incorrect system configuration.
This guide explains the step-by-step process of Odoo ERP implementation for businesses in Qatar, helping you understand how to implement the system properly and avoid costly mistakes.
Why Businesses in Qatar Are Moving to Odoo ERP
Many companies start with separate systems for accounting, sales, inventory, and operations. Over time, these disconnected tools create problems such as:
Duplicate data entry
Reporting inconsistencies
Manual processes that slow down operations
Lack of real-time business insights
Odoo ERP solves this by connecting all business operations into a single system. With proper implementation, businesses can manage sales, accounting, inventory, purchasing, and reporting in one integrated platform.
However, ERP success depends heavily on implementation strategy, not just software selection.
Step 1: Define Your Business Requirements Clearly
Before implementing Odoo ERP, businesses must first understand their internal processes.
This includes identifying:
Current operational challenges
Departments that need automation
Existing software being used
Reporting requirements for management
Without clear business requirements, ERP implementation becomes guesswork. Many companies rush into ERP projects without proper analysis, which later leads to expensive adjustments.
At this stage, businesses should focus on process clarity rather than software features.
Step 2: Choose the Right Odoo Implementation Partner
ERP implementation is not just about installing software. It requires deep knowledge of business processes, configuration, customization, and integration.
Working with an experienced implementation partner helps businesses avoid:
Incorrect module configuration
Data migration errors
Poor workflow setup
Integration failures
Businesses looking for reliable implementation support can explore Best Odoo Partners in Qatar to understand how professional implementation services ensure a smoother ERP deployment.
A qualified partner ensures the system is configured according to your business structure rather than forcing your business to adjust to the system.
Step 3: System Design and ERP Architecture Planning
Once requirements are defined, the next step is designing the ERP structure.
This stage includes:
Selecting the required Odoo modules
Defining workflow automation
Planning user roles and permissions
Structuring departments and business units
ERP architecture planning ensures that the system reflects real business operations.
For example:
Trading companies may need strong inventory management
Service companies may prioritize project management and invoicing
Retail businesses require POS and stock tracking
Proper planning ensures that the ERP system supports your daily operations rather than creating unnecessary complexity.
Step 4: Odoo Configuration and Customization
After system planning, the next stage is configuring Odoo based on business workflows.
This includes:
Setting up company structure
Configuring accounting workflows
Creating product and inventory structures
Setting up sales and purchase processes
Configuring automated reports
Some businesses may also require customization if their workflows are unique.
However, excessive customization should be avoided. A good implementation focuses on using Odoo's standard features whenever possible while customizing only where necessary.
Step 5: Data Migration From Existing Systems
One of the most sensitive parts of ERP implementation is data migration.
Businesses typically migrate:
Customer records
Vendor databases
Product catalogs
Historical transactions
Accounting records
Poor data migration can cause reporting errors and operational issues.
Before migration, data should always be:
Cleaned
Verified
Structured correctly
Proper data preparation ensures that the ERP system starts with accurate and reliable information.
Step 6: Testing the ERP System
Before going live, the entire system must go through multiple testing stages.
This process includes:
Workflow testing
Financial reporting validation
Sales and purchase process checks
Inventory movement testing
User access verification
Testing ensures that all modules work correctly together.
Skipping proper testing is one of the most common causes of ERP implementation failure.
Step 7: Employee Training and System Adoption
Even the best ERP system will fail if employees do not understand how to use it.
Businesses must train employees on:
Daily workflows
Data entry processes
Reporting tools
Department-specific modules
Proper training improves user adoption and reduces operational confusion during the transition period.
ERP success is not only technical; it also depends on how well teams adopt the system.
Step 8: Go-Live and Post-Implementation Support
After successful testing and training, the system can officially go live.
However, ERP implementation does not end at deployment.
Businesses still need:
Performance monitoring
Minor workflow adjustments
Technical support
System optimization
Continuous improvement ensures that the ERP system evolves with business growth.
At Top Cliff Consultancy, we help businesses not only implement Odoo ERP but also optimize it continuously to ensure long-term operational efficiency.
Common Odoo ERP Implementation Mistakes Businesses Should Avoid
Many ERP projects face problems because of avoidable mistakes such as:
Implementing ERP without process analysis
Choosing inexperienced implementation partners
Migrating incorrect or incomplete data
Skipping proper system testing
Lack of employee training
Avoiding these mistakes significantly increases the success rate of ERP implementation projects.
Final Thoughts
Odoo ERP implementation can transform how businesses operate by connecting accounting, sales, inventory, and operations into a single system.
However, the success of ERP depends on structured planning, expert implementation, and continuous optimization.
Businesses in Qatar that follow a proper ERP implementation strategy can improve operational efficiency, reduce manual work, and gain better visibility into their business performance.
At Top Cliff Consultancy, we help companies implement Odoo ERP the right way — ensuring the system supports business growth instead of creating technical challenges.
FAQs
1. How Long Does Odoo ERP Implementation Take For Businesses In Qatar?
The implementation timeline depends on business size, number of modules, and customization requirements. Small projects may take a few weeks, while larger ERP implementations can take several months.
2. What Is The First Step In Odoo ERP Implementation?
The first step is defining business requirements and identifying operational challenges that the ERP system needs to solve.
3. Can Odoo ERP Be Customized For Different Industries?
Yes, Odoo ERP can be customized to support different industries such as trading, retail, manufacturing, and service businesses.
4. Why Do Some ERP Implementations Fail?
ERP implementations usually fail because of poor planning, incorrect system configuration, lack of testing, or choosing inexperienced implementation partners.
5. How Can Top Cliff Consultancy Help With Odoo ERP Implementation?
Top Cliff Consultancy helps businesses analyze their processes, implement Odoo ERP correctly, migrate data safely, and provide ongoing system optimization and support.